Do you even lift? 

a condescending expression used on body building and fitness forums to question the legitimacy of someone’s fitness expertise or weight lifting routine. Similar to other interrogatives like “U Mad?” or “U Jelly?”, the phrase is mainly used to aggravate another user during arguments about physical fitness.

Do you even lift? 

While used frequently in fitness and bodybuilding chatrooms and forums, it is also used as an amusing non-sequitur to express general exasperation or derision in situations not involving fitness or bodybuilding.
